The Spirit of Pocahontas was a musical show based on the film Pocahontas that took place in Fantasyland Theater at Disneyland from 1995 to 1997[1], and in Backlot Theater at Disney's Hollywood Studios from 1995 to 1996.
Show summary[]
The show creatively retells the story from the perspective of the storyteller Werowance and the Powhatan tribe. They bring to life the legend of Pocahontas. When Pocahontas is summoned, Werowance takes on the role of her father, Chief Powhatan. To represent the English settlers, members of the tribe don silver ceremonial masks. But the part of English adventurer John Smith calls for more than a silver mask. Werowance makes John Smith materialize from a burning campfire.
Throughout the show’s half hour, you’ll be dazzled by talented performers, clever special effects (including fire and wind), and the memorable score and songs by Alan Menken and Stephen Schwartz. In a particularly effective scene, the puppet face of Grandmother Willow appears on a huge willow tree to offer guidance to Pocahontas and John Smith.
